High-frequency ultrasound therapy has become a popular option for pain relief. It utilizes sound waves greater than the range of click here human hearing to generate thermal outcomes within tissues. There are two primary wavebands commonly employed: 1 MHz and 3 MHz.
- The 1 MHz frequency targets deeper structures, making it effective for issues such as muscle strains, ligament sprains, and arthritis.
- On the other hand, 3 MHz waves are more shallow in their penetration. They are appropriate for treating topical pain, inflammation, and soft tissue ailments.
As a result, the determination of frequency depends on the particular pain area and underlying cause.
